Full Description

Nervous about tough interview questions? Many candidates know their resume but freeze when faced with tricky or unexpected queries. Interviews test not just knowledge but presence, clarity, and how well you understand what's being asked. What if you could decode every question, respond with confidence, and walk into any interview knowing you are prepared? By learning the hidden language behind each question, you can turn uncertainty into calm, credible communication that leaves a lasting impression.



Question-decoding toolkit: target exactly what hiring managers measure, not what they merely ask.



Visual breakdowns: lock lessons in memory with clear color-coded cues you recall under pressure.



Authentic answer framework: balance credibility, humility, and personal fit in every response.



Stage-by-stage guidance: adapt messaging for phone screens, panels, and final salary talks.



Job-description mapping: predict likely questions before you walk into the room. 
Real transcripts: compare great and clueless answers, then refine your own.

In Interview Speak, career advisors Barbara Limmer and Laura Browne combine decades of hiring experience into a practical soft-cover guide. Their proven methods have helped thousands of professionals worldwide secure offers.

The book dissects dozens of common, tricky, and curveball questions, showing what each really tests. Color graphics reveal subtext, while checklists walk you from preparation to follow-up. You'll practice with annotated sample answers, then build your own.

Finish the last chapter able to decode any question, craft a clear story, and negotiate with calm authority. You will leave interviews knowing you impressed the decision makers.

Ideal for new graduates, career changers, and seasoned pros who refuse to wing their next interview.
